jquery 判断是手机端还是电脑端
warning:
这篇文章距离上次修改已过192天,其中的内容可能已经有所变动。
您可以使用jQuery的$.browser
方法来判断用户设备是手机还是电脑端。但是,从jQuery 1.9版本开始,$.browser
已经被移除。因此,您可以使用$.support
或者用户代理字符串(User Agent String)来判断。
以下是一个示例代码,用于判断设备是手机还是电脑:
$(document).ready(function() {
var isMobile = /Android|webOS|iPhone|iPad|iPod|BlackBerry|IEMobile|Opera Mini/i.test(navigator.userAgent);
if (isMobile) {
// 手机端
console.log("Mobile Device");
} else {
// 电脑端
console.log("Desktop Device");
}
});
这段代码通过正则表达式检查navigator.userAgent
字符串,以判断是否是常见的移动设备用户代理之一。如果是,则判断为移动设备(手机端);否则,为电脑端。
评论已关闭